What's Beyond? B

Exercise Intermediate 15 min 1–1

Description

In this individual exercise, the player reflects on events that occurred off stage after leaving their last scene. The focus is on creating a vivid backstory based on their previous setting.

Setup Requirements

Open space for a single performer to move comfortably.

Point of Concentration

Suggest what went on in the place off stage.

Side Coaching

  • Encourage players to keep it simple when starting out.
  • Prompt them to build complexity as they progress in the session.

Points of Observation

  • Look for clarity in the backstory being constructed.
  • Note how the player connects their offstage scene to their current performance.

Evaluation

  • What happened off stage?
  • How did the past influence the present action?

Examples

Examples of offstage events include:
  • Shoveling snow off the driveway.
  • A quarrel with a partner.
  • Stealing a purse.
  • A dramatic death scene.
